Sammendrag

Undisturbed peatlands provide essential grazing and movement of landscapes for reindeer husbandry. Cumulative land-use pressures and climate change are fragmenting pastures and reducing their grazing quality, blocking traditional migration, undermining animal well-being and Indigenous livelihoods. Loss of access to traditional pasture areas erodes Indigenous knowledge and cultural continuity.
